Indian tunics are feminine and fun. They are available in a wide variety colors, fabrics and designs. Often light weight, they are ideal on a hot summer day but may also be worn layered in the fall or winter. Bright fun colors and designs are popular among teen girls and college students while a muted color in a natural fabric is both beautiful and classy on a woman of any age. Of course there are bright and exotic designs for any woman confident enough to wear one. The unique design of the Indian tunic makes them versatile while appealing to the world traveler or anyone open-minded enough to sample the wares and customs available in other cultures. Initially only seen on women of Indian descent, the brightly colored and sometimes ornate tunics are also making their way into the mainstream.
